Design and Construction

The WCB Electric Globe Valve is primarily constructed from a high-quality carbon steel material, typically WCB (wrought carbon steel), which provides excellent strength and durability. The design features a spherical body shape, with an internal mechanism that controls flow through the valve by raising or lowering a disc within the valve body. The configuration allows for a straightforward yet effective means of regulating fluid flow, making it ideal for high-pressure applications. The electric actuator attached to the globe valve provides automation and precision. Unlike manual valves that require physical effort to operate, the electric actuator can be controlled remotely or integrated into an automated system, allowing for easy adjustments without the need for manual intervention. This feature enhances operational efficiency and safety, particularly in hazardous environments where manual operation may pose risks.
